(2) Any unpaid balance of the award not paid in a lump sum payment shall be paid pursuant to ORS 656.216.

(3) In all cases where the award for permanent partial disability does not exceed $6,000, the insurer or the self-insured employer shall pay all of the award to the worker in a lump sum. [Amended by 1957 c.574 §4; 1959 c.449 §1; 1965 c.285 §23a; 1973 c.221 §1; 1981 c.854 §13; 1983 c.816 §15; 1995 c.332 §22; 2007 c.270 §1]
